Merge pull request #2109 from pateljannat/issues-186

fix: check permission of session user during batch enrollment
This commit is contained in:
Jannat Patel
2026-02-23 11:36:49 +05:30
committed by GitHub

View File

@@ -26,7 +26,7 @@ class LMSBatchEnrollment(Document):
if self.owner == self.member:
return
roles = frappe.get_roles(self.owner)
roles = frappe.get_roles()
if "Moderator" not in roles and "Batch Evaluator" not in roles:
frappe.throw(_("You must be a Moderator or Batch Evaluator to enroll users in a batch."))